Babachir, others docked, remanded in EFCC custody

JUSTICE Jude Okeke of the High Court of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), today ordered that the immediate past Secretary to the Government of the Federation (SGF), Engineer Babachir David Lawal and three others be remanded in the custody of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) till tomorrow when the court will rule on their bail applications.
The judge gave the order following the arraignment if the former government scribe and three other individuals and two companies on a 10-count charge bordering on fraud.
Others arraigned with Lawal are his company, a director of the company, Hamidu David Lawal; an employee of the company, Sulaiman Abubakar; and the Managing Director of Josmon Technologies Limited, Apeh John Monday; Rholavision Engineering Limited.
Counsel for Babachir, Chief Akin Olujinmi SAN, moved an oral application for his bail, saying that his client had served Nigeria meritorious to the level of Secretary to the Government of the Federation.
Counsel for other defendants, Sunday Ameh SAN, Napoleon Edenala, Ocholi Okutekpa and M E Oru, also moved bail applications for their respective clients.
